我将这些文件复制到C:\MonoWebServer。
xsp2.exe
xsp2.exe.mdb
Mono.WebServer2.dll
Mono.Security.dll
我在GAC中注册了Mono.WebServer2.dll & Mono.Security.dll。当我运行xsp2.exe时,我得到。

我到底做错了什么!
Windows 7-64位
发布于 2012-03-30 00:36:57
好了,我已经把它弄好了。以下是步骤。
文件结构应该如下所示。
WebSite
--bin
--内容
--模型
--视图
xsp4.exe
Mono.Security.dll
笔记
我不知道为什么,但是xsp根据Server类的程序集名创建了一个新的MonoWebServer实例。因此,当它试图解决它时,它默认在bin文件夹中查找。这就是为什么你必须将xsp和所有依赖文件复制到bin文件夹。
您可以从安装最新版本的Mono.Security.dll获得文件xsp2.exe、xsp4.exe、Mono & Mono.WebServer2.dll。
框架版本
这适用于基于.NET 4.0构建的网站。如果您尝试部署GAC2.0站点,那么您将需要在.NET中注册Mono.Security.dll & Mono.WebServer2.dll,并使用xsp2.exe而不是xsp4.exe。
部署
Xsp web服务器不需要Mono框架就可以在安装了.NET框架的Windows计算机上运行。
https://stackoverflow.com/questions/9747169
复制相似问题